## Context Epochs
V2 Sessions persist the exact privileged System Context shown to the model. A Context Epoch owns one immutable baseline plus a model-hidden structured snapshot used to compare independently observed Context Sources. Environment facts, the host-local date, and ambient global/upward-project `AGENTS.md` files are the initial registered sources.
The first complete observation initializes the epoch before any pending prompt becomes model-visible. If initial context is temporarily unavailable, execution stops while the prompt remains pending and retryable. On later provider turns, the runner promotes eligible input first, then reconciles current sources at the safe boundary. Changed context becomes one durable chronological System message, and its event commit advances the epoch snapshot atomically.

Model switches and completed compactions request lazy baseline replacement. A Session move clears the epoch so the destination Location must initialize a complete baseline before promoting more input. Epoch creation is fenced against the authoritative Session Location, preventing an old-Location runner from recreating stale privileged context after a concurrent move.

Ambient project discovery canonicalizes and contains traversal within the project root and honors `OPENCODE_DISABLE_PROJECT_CONFIG`. An unavailable observation preserves the previously admitted value. A confirmed partial instruction removal emits the complete remaining aggregate with explicit supersession text; removing the final instruction emits a revocation message.

Provider timeout, retry, and watchdog policy is intentionally deferred. The runner does not impose a universal provider-stream inactivity or absolute timeout. A future slice should design configurable policy around provider behavior, durable failure reporting, and local drain-chain release rather than hardcoding one default for every provider.
